Transaction ad22826215fed6708f48a3769514df84a52c0212381c9cd6c428519ea30f47ae
1 Input
2 Outputs
- ad22826215fed6708f48a3769514df84a52c0212381c9cd6c428519ea30f47ae:0
- ad22826215fed6708f48a3769514df84a52c0212381c9cd6c428519ea30f47ae:1
value 170700
address 3Qea3jA4P3ztCzUAWwd1k144WEzXhoSc3Z
value 1320958
address 1rGEe3orLxMPrVxg6xNFQ7AfsBhN9sS2y